Hey everyone,
I’m on Figma’s Professional Plan, and I’ve been trying to figure out how to distinguish between full team members, limited-access team members, and guests in a file or project, and in my team members list. However, I’ve noticed some confusing behaviors:
In the Members page under Team Settings, even guests appear alongside team members.
Some team members only have access to specific files rather than the entire team’s projects, making it unclear who my full team members are.
When I click Share on a file, it only explicitly lists guests. For team members, it just says "People in [Team Name] have access" without listing their names.
This makes it difficult to quickly determine who is a full team member, who is a guest, and which team members have access only to certain files. Is there a reliable way to tell them apart? How can I see a list of my full team members who have access to everything and be able to distinguish them from my limited-access members and guests?
